My flame arrestor flowed enough and it actually ran worse without it as it seemed to straiten and settle the air going in. What was eye opening was cracking the hatch and gaining some solid rpm. The afr didn’t change at all, but the engine was thirsty for better air and more of it.

Not to say that various boat manufactures are light on ventilation but then we increase the power by 30 to 50% and in some cases double from stock and then only compounds the problem. More vents in the right places the better.
